As a landlord, you have a lot on your plate. From tenant issues to property maintenance, it can be overwhelming to navigate the legalities of being a landlord while also managing your property. That’s where landlord solicitors come in. They are legal professionals who specialize in landlord-tenant law and can provide you with the guidance and support you need to protect your rights and interests.
One of the main reasons why you need a landlord solicitor is to ensure that you are complying with all relevant laws and regulations. Landlord-tenant law is a complex and ever-changing field, and it can be difficult to keep up with all of the latest developments on your own. A solicitor who specializes in this area of law will be able to advise you on your rights and obligations as a landlord, as well as help you navigate any legal disputes that may arise with your tenants.
Another key reason to hire a landlord solicitor is to assist you in drafting and reviewing important legal documents. From lease agreements to eviction notices, there are a number of legal documents that you will need to create and execute as a landlord. A solicitor can help you ensure that these documents are legally sound and will hold up in court if challenged.
In addition, a landlord solicitor can also represent you in court if you are involved in a legal dispute with your tenant. Whether you are facing an eviction proceeding or a claim for damages, having a solicitor on your side can make a significant difference in the outcome of your case. They will be able to advocate on your behalf and ensure that your rights are protected throughout the legal process.
Furthermore, landlord solicitors can provide you with valuable advice on how to avoid legal disputes in the first place. By reviewing your rental agreements and property management practices, they can help you identify any potential legal pitfalls and make necessary adjustments to minimize your legal risk. This proactive approach can save you time, money, and stress in the long run.
When selecting a landlord solicitor, it is important to choose someone who has experience in landlord-tenant law and a track record of success representing landlords. Look for a solicitor who is familiar with the local laws and regulations in your area, as these can vary significantly from one jurisdiction to another. Additionally, consider their communication style and availability, as you will want to work with someone who is responsive and attentive to your needs.
